The fabled "Santa Claus rally" has eluded us thus far. Stocks
are down more than 3% this month and the window of opportunity is
fast closing with just a few more trading sessions left. If St.
Nickolas continues to look for inspiration from Mario Draghi, the
president of European Central Bank, then we should probably head
out for holidays ahead of time.
There is some positive news out of Europe this morning, with a
key German business confidence survey coming in better than
expected. We also have Spanish government bond yields coming down
following a successful auction. But we will have to see if these
readings will be enough to carry us through the day.
There is not much positive happening on the domestic front
either. We have better than expected November Housing Starts
numbers this morning, but it is unlikely to cheer the mood all by
itself. Even the temporary payroll tax extension, earlier agreed to
by the Senate by a wide margin, has run into difficulty in the
House. I find it hard to imagine that Congress will let this
measure expire, but stranger things have happened in the recent
past. So, it shouldn’t entirely come as a surprise.
In corporate news, Red Hat (RHT), the seller of
the open-source Linux operating system, reported weaker than
expected billings and revenue for its fiscal third quarter.
AT&T (T) has withdrawn its $39 billion bid for
T-Mobile USA in the face of resistance from the
Justice department on anti-trust grounds. On the earnings front, we
have better than expected results from ConAgra
Foods (CAG) this morning, while Oracle
(ORCL) and Nike (NKE) report after the close
today.
